Hi, I need to create a super admin account (top level admin) but I need to stop that user from deleting the main Super Admin account.
How can I do this?
#2 / Jul 05, 2010 4:05pm
I don’t think that you can. Superadmins, by definition, are all-powerful administrative users. If you don’t trust somebody completely, don’t make them Superadmins.
Even if you had EE check the group_id of the other user, a Superadmin could just run some arbitrary SQL to effect that.

I’ve created a new group called Top Level Admin but given them all the rights, however only some sections are accessible by Super Admins yet the Top Level Admin appears to have the rights to delete the Super Admin Account.
Is this correct?
#4 / Jul 05, 2010 4:39pm
Have you actually tried it with a real Superadmin account? I don’t think a non-Superadmin can delete such an account, but other Superadmins should be able to.
#5 / Oct 19, 2010 6:55pm
I know it’s been a while since this thread started, but just thought I’d confirm Ingmar’s post. I set up a test Super Admin, and generic Admin and only Super Admins can delete a Super Admin account.
The tricky thing is that it lets you get all the way through the process and then gives you the “error” message after you confirm that you want to delete the account.
Not a big deal in light of the more pressing issues that EL is working on, but it seems like a nice feature would be to not even show the Delete option (or really any management options for the Super Admin).
